One of the factors which highly affects the economic effectiveness of production enterprises is the level of the use of technical means. This factor is also significant for mining companies extracting coal. The optimal use of mining machines can impact the future of these companies. The paper presents the authors’ solution which is an informatics platform supporting an analysis of the mining machines’ effectiveness. It uses a data warehouse to archive, synchronize and analytically process the data obtained from the studied machines. The article shows an example of applying an informatics platform to investigate the effectiveness of the longwall shearer’s work. The analysis was based on the data obtained from the industrial automation system. Afterwards, the shearer’s availability and performance, and quality of the product, which is coal, were determined. The developed tool should find wide practical application in production companies across different kinds of industries.

This paper aims to study for accurate sheet trim shower position for paper making process. An accurate position is required in an automation system. A mathematical model of DC motor is used to obtain a transfer function between shaft position and applied voltage. PID controller with Ziegler-Nichols and Hang-tuning rule and Fuzzy logic controller for controlling position accuracy are required. The result reference explains it that the FLC is better than other methods and performance characteristics also improve the control of DC motor.
